Subject: [PATCH 23/29] ASoC: codecs: use asoc_substream_to_rtd()
Date: 20 Jul 2020 10:19:27 +0900	[thread overview]
Message-ID: <871rl70yse.wl-kuninori.morimoto.gx@renesas.com> (raw)
In-Reply-To: <87y2nf0yw2.wl-kuninori.morimoto.gx@renesas.com>


From: Kuninori Morimoto <kuninori.morimoto.gx@renesas.com>

Now we can use asoc_substream_to_rtd() macro,
let's use it.

Signed-off-by: Kuninori Morimoto <kuninori.morimoto.gx@renesas.com>
---
 sound/soc/codecs/rt5677-spi.c | 4 ++--
 1 file changed, 2 insertions(+), 2 deletions(-)

diff --git a/sound/soc/codecs/rt5677-spi.c b/sound/soc/codecs/rt5677-spi.c
index 95ac12a5cc6b..8f3993a4c1cc 100644
--- a/sound/soc/codecs/rt5677-spi.c
+++ b/sound/soc/codecs/rt5677-spi.c
@@ -112,7 +112,7 @@ static int rt5677_spi_pcm_close(
 		struct snd_soc_component *component,
 		struct snd_pcm_substream *substream)
 {
-	struct snd_soc_pcm_runtime *rtd = substream->private_data;
+	struct snd_soc_pcm_runtime *rtd = asoc_substream_to_rtd(substream);
 	struct snd_soc_component *codec_component =
 			snd_soc_rtdcom_lookup(rtd, "rt5677");
 	struct rt5677_priv *rt5677 =
@@ -158,7 +158,7 @@ static int rt5677_spi_prepare(
 		struct snd_soc_component *component,
 		struct snd_pcm_substream *substream)
 {
-	struct snd_soc_pcm_runtime *rtd = substream->private_data;
+	struct snd_soc_pcm_runtime *rtd = asoc_substream_to_rtd(substream);
 	struct snd_soc_component *rt5677_component =
 			snd_soc_rtdcom_lookup(rtd, "rt5677");
 	struct rt5677_priv *rt5677 =
